Galgotias University has been ranked among India’s leading higher education institutions in the QS World University Rankings 2026 released by Quacquarelli Symonds (QS). The university placed 15th among private universities in India and 43rd among all Indian universities, reflecting its growing national and regional standing.
In the QS World University Rankings: Asia 2026, Galgotias University has been positioned 116th in Southern Asia and 454th across Asia, highlighting its presence among emerging universities in the region.
The university also received the QS Recognition Award for Global Engagement – Performance Improvement, acknowledging efforts to expand international partnerships and enhance cross-border academic collaboration.
